HLTH 5150 Principles of Public Health and Health Promotion (3 credits)
This course is designed to provide entry-level health education and community health students with the historical and ethical foundations, concepts, models, theories, strategies, and applications to promote individual, family, and community well-being. Prerequisite(s): None.
